Unpacking the A1C Test: The Long-Term Perspective
The A1C test, also known as the glycated hemoglobin test, measures the percentage of your red blood cells that have glucose attached to them. Glucose, a type of sugar, binds to hemoglobin, the protein in red blood cells that carries oxygen. The more glucose in your blood, the more glucose will bind to hemoglobin. Since red blood cells live for about three months, the A1C test provides an average of your blood sugar levels over that period.
Key Benefits of the A1C Test:
- Long-Term View: Provides a broad overview of blood sugar control, reducing the impact of daily fluctuations.
- Convenience: Doesn't require fasting, making it easier to schedule.
- Comprehensive Assessment: Helps healthcare providers adjust treatment plans based on consistent patterns rather than isolated incidents.
Understanding A1C Results:
The A1C result is given as a percentage. Here's a general guideline for interpreting A1C levels:

Example: An A1C of 7% indicates that, on average, your blood sugar level has been around 154 mg/dL over the past 2-3 months.
Limitations of the A1C Test:
Despite its usefulness, the A1C test isn't perfect. It has some limitations that should be considered:

- Not Suitable for All: Conditions like anemia, hemoglobin variants, or kidney disease can affect A1C results.
- Doesn't Capture Fluctuations: While it shows the average, it doesn't reveal daily swings or episodes of hypoglycemia (low blood sugar).
- Delayed Insight: Represents past blood sugar levels, so changes in diet or medication won't be reflected immediately.
Example Scenario: Two individuals have the same A1C of 7%. One person consistently maintains their blood sugar around 154 mg/dL. The other experiences frequent highs and lows that average out to 154 mg/dL. While their A1C is the same, their overall blood sugar control is vastly different. This highlights the need for supplemental BG testing.
Diving into Blood Glucose (BG) Testing: Real-Time Insights
Blood Glucose (BG) testing, often performed using a glucometer, provides an immediate snapshot of your blood sugar levels. This test involves pricking your finger with a lancet and placing a drop of blood on a test strip, which is then read by the glucometer.
Benefits of Blood Glucose Testing:
- Immediate Feedback: Reveals the impact of food, exercise, stress, and medication on blood sugar levels in real-time.
- Hypoglycemia Detection: Essential for identifying and preventing dangerous drops in blood sugar.
- Treatment Adjustment: Allows for immediate adjustments to insulin doses or meal plans.
Understanding Blood Glucose Results:
Blood glucose levels are measured in milligrams per deciliter (mg/dL) or millimoles per liter (mmol/L). Target ranges vary depending on individual factors, but general guidelines are:
| Time of Day | Target Range (mg/dL) | |-----------------|----------------------| | Before Meals | 80-130 | | 1-2 Hours After Meals | Less than 180 |
Example: If you test your blood sugar before dinner and the reading is 160 mg/dL, it indicates your blood sugar is higher than the recommended target. Limitations of Blood Glucose Testing:
- Snapshot in Time: Only reflects blood sugar at the moment of testing and doesn't provide a comprehensive view of long-term control.
- User Error: Accuracy depends on proper technique, calibration of the glucometer, and quality of test strips.
- Inconvenience: Requires frequent finger pricks, which can be uncomfortable and time-consuming.
Example Scenario: A person tests their blood sugar after a workout and finds it's 90 mg/dL. This reading is within the target range, suggesting their blood sugar is well-controlled at that moment. However, it doesn't reveal whether their blood sugar was consistently high earlier in the day or if they experienced a sudden drop during exercise.

Continuous Glucose Monitoring (CGM): The Advanced Option
For individuals who require more frequent and detailed monitoring, Continuous Glucose Monitoring (CGM) systems offer a valuable alternative. CGMs use a small sensor inserted under the skin to continuously measure glucose levels in the interstitial fluid. These systems provide real-time glucose readings and trend data, helping users make informed decisions about their diabetes management.
Benefits of CGM:
- Continuous Monitoring: Provides glucose readings every few minutes, offering a more comprehensive view of blood sugar fluctuations.
- Trend Arrows: Indicates the direction and rate of change in glucose levels, allowing for proactive adjustments.
- Alerts and Alarms: Notifies users of high or low glucose levels, helping prevent potentially dangerous episodes.
Comparison: CGMs don't replace the A1C test, as the A1C still provides a valuable long-term average. However, CGMs can significantly enhance daily blood sugar management and improve overall glycemic control.
